Heard Mr. Thakkar, learned counsel for the applicant and Mr. Thakare, learned Additional Public Prosecutor for non applicant-State. Also, perused the entire charge-sheet.

Applicant is arrested in connection with Crime No.188/2018 registered with Police Station, Muktai Nagar, Dist. Jalgaon for an offence punishable under Sections 302 , 201, 202, 203, 120B read with Section 34 of the Indian Penal Code.

One Praful Bhole intimated to Police Station, Malkapur that a girl, aged about 6 to 7 years is found to be in dead condition in a dry well situated in field Gat No.18/3 belonging to him. On the basis of the said, initially Accidental Death No.42/2018 was registered at Police Station, Malkapur. The body was in decomposed condition. Postmortem was conducted and for DNA profiling, bones were retained. The investigator registered an offence vide

Crime No.387/2018 against unknown persons.

In the meanwhile, dead body of one fully grown woman was found within the territorial jurisdiction of Police Station, Muktai Nagar, Dist. Jalgaon. Therefore, an offence was registered vide Crime No. 188/2018.

During the investigation it is surfaced that the girl who was done to death was Humera, whereas the dead body of woman which was found in the jurisdiction of Muktai Nagar Police Station was found to be of Shabanabee Shaikh. During the investigation it was found that she was wife of Shaikh Aslam Shaikh Salim and Humera was his daughter. Shaikh Aslam is arrested.

Two different charge-sheets are filed in two aforesaid crimes registered with Police Station, Malkapur and Police Station, Muktai Nagar. Ultimately those crimes were culminated into registration of Sessions Trial No. 43/2019 and Sessions Trial No. 63/2019. Sessions Trial No.43/2019 was pending on the file of Additional Sessions Judge, Bhusawal whereas Sessions Trial No. 63/2019 is pending on the file of Additional Sessions Judge, Malkapur. Criminal Application (APPLN) No. 44/2019 was filed before this Court by co-accused Sk. Aslam s/o Sk. Salim and present applicant who is brother of co-accused Sk. Aslam, for transferring Sessions Trial No.43/2019 pending on the file of Additional Sessions Judge, Bhusawal to the file of Additional Sessions Judge, Malkapur. This Court (Coram : Mrs. Swapna Joshi, J.) on 09.09.2019 allowed Criminal Application (APPLN) No. 44/2019 and transferred

the Sessions Trial No.43/2019 from the file of Additional Sessions Judge, Bhusawal to Additional Sessions Judge, Malkapur and accordingly it is submitted before this Court that both Sessions Trial are pending before the Additional Sessions Judge, Malkapur. It is also disclosed to this Court that charges are not yet framed.

This applicant had moved Criminal Application (BA) No.898/2019 before this Court for bail in Crime No.387/2018 and this Court after hearing the learned counsel for the applicant and learned Additional Public Prosecutor for State found that there is only allegation against the applicant in the said crime that he helped the main accused - Shaikh Aslam Shaikh Salim to destroy the evidence. In view of the said and looking to the fact that charge-sheet was already filed, vide order dated 09.10.2019 he was released on bail by this Court in connection with Crime No.387/2018.

The applicant is also arrested in connection with Crime No.188/2018 and since then he in jail. Said crime is culminated into Sessions Trial No.43/2019 which is now transferred and pending on the file of learned Additional Sessions Judge, Malkapur in view of the order passed by this Court in transfer petition as referred above. After hearing the learned counsel for the applicant as well as learned Additional Public Prosecutor for the State in respect of the role of the present applicant qua Crime No.188/2018, it is revealed to this Court by learned Additional Public Prosecutor that role attributed to the

present applicant is that he has helped the main accused to destroy the evidence. Since that is the only role and this Court has already exercised discretion in favour of the applicant in Crime No.387/2018, looking to the said role, in my view, present application is required to be allowed. Consequently, I pass the following order:

ORDER

(i) The application is allowed.

(ii) Applicant - Sk. Akram s/o Sk. Salim be released on bail in connection with Crime No.188/2018 registered with Police Station, Muktai Nagar, Dist. Jalgaon for an offence punishable under Sections 302 , 201, 202, 203, 120B read with Section 34 of the Indian Penal Code, on he executing P.R. bond in the sum of 50,000/- with one ₹ solvent surety in the like amount.

(iii) Applicant is directed to attend Police Station, Malkapur (City), Dist. Buldhana twice in a month i.e. on third Tuesday and fourth Sunday and shall be with the investigating officer from 11:00 a.m. to 03:00 p.m., until culmination of trial.

The application is disposed of.
